OverviewInstacart is the North American leader in online grocery, and behind every seamless customer experience is a world-class engineering organization building the systems that make it all possible. The Developer Experience team sits at the heart of that engineering organization, focused on empowering engineers across Instacart to do their best work - faster, more reliably, and with less friction.
As a Senior Software Engineer II on the Developer Experience team, you will play a critical role in shaping the internal tooling, infrastructure, and platforms that Instacart engineers depend on every day. This is a high-impact, high-ownership role for an engineer who is energized by building for other builders - someone who understands that improving developer productivity at scale can have an outsized effect on what the entire company is able to ship.
About the Job- Design, build, and maintain internal developer tooling, platforms, and infrastructure that improve the productivity, reliability, and experience of engineering teams across Instacart.
- Own complex technical initiatives end-to-end, from scoping and architecture through implementation, rollout, and iteration - operating with a high degree of autonomy and accountability.
- Identify friction points in the developer experience through data, feedback, and direct collaboration with engineering teams, and drive solutions that meaningfully reduce toil and improve velocity at scale.
- Contribute to the technical direction of the team, participating in design reviews, code reviews, and architectural discussions that shape how Instacart builds and scales its internal platforms.
- Thrive in a fast-moving, ambiguous environment where priorities can shift and where your ability to adapt quickly and make sound technical decisions under uncertainty is a genuine asset.
About YouMinimum Qualifications- 8+ years of professional software engineering experience, with a strong track record of delivering complex technical systems in production environments.
- Proficiency in one or more backend languages commonly used in platform or infrastructure contexts (e.g., Go, Ruby, Python, Java, or similar).
- Experience building or contributing to developer tooling, internal platforms, CI/CD systems, or developer productivity infrastructure.
- Demonstrated ability to lead technical projects independently, including scoping, designing, and delivering solutions with cross-functional impact.
- Strong communication skills with the ability to collaborate effectively across engineering teams and articulate technical trade-offs clearly.
Preferred Qualifications- Experience working on a Developer Experience, Platform Engineering, or Infrastructure team with a focus on improving engineering workflows at scale.
- Familiarity with observability tooling, build systems, or developer environment management (e.g., Bazel, Docker, Kubernetes, or similar).
- Experience in a high-growth technology company where the pace of change is fast and the scope of technical challenges is broad.
- A track record of influencing engineering culture or best practices beyond your immediate team.

Instacart provides highly market-competitive compensation and benefits in each location where our employees work. This role is remote and the base pay range for a successful candidate is dependent on their permanent work location. Please review our Flex First remote work policy here. Currently, we are only hiring in the following provinces: Ontario, Alberta, British Columbia, and Nova Scotia.
Offers may vary based on many factors, such as candidate experience and skills required for the role. Additionally, this role is eligible for a new hire equity grant as well as annual refresh grants. Please read more about our benefits offerings here.
For Canadian based candidates, the base pay ranges for a successful candidate are listed below.
CAN
$196,000-$207,000 CAD
